Getting Started

Prerequisites

Ensure that Node.js and MongoDB are installed on your machine.

Add your own configurations for environment variables used to environment file.

Run seeder.js file at seeder folder to get the blogs for development environment.

🛠️ Installation

  1. Clone the repository
git clone https://github.com/singhJasvinder101/MyBlog.git
  1. Navigate to the project's client directory:
cd client
  1. Install dependencies
npm install
  1. Navigate to the project's backend directory:
cd.. 
cd backend
  1. Install dependencies
npm install
  1. Start the development server at backend directory:
npm run both

🤝 Contributing

If you'd like to contribute to TechBytes, please follow these steps:

  1. Fork the repository.
  2. Create a new branch for your feature or bug fix.
  3. Make changes and commit them.
  4. Push your changes to your fork.
  5. Create a pull request.

Note: Make sure you always create a updated PR.
